Job description

Automation & Operations Project Manager (12-Months FTC)

Join us at GXO Logistics, Inc. as an Automation & Operations Project Manager for a 12-month fixed-term contract based in Lutterworth. This role involves managing and optimizing the product flow within a dynamic retail automation environment for our customer, Primark.

Details:

  • Full-time, Monday to Friday, 08:00 – 16:30
  • Salary up to £60,000 per annum
  • Benefits include 25 days' annual leave, pension scheme, private medical & dental insurance, online GP, life assurance, employee assistance program, and various discounts via MyBenefits platform.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Ensure seamless product flow through automated systems
  • Collaborate with Operations, IT, Logistics, and Suppliers
  • Drive performance through data insights and continuous improvement
  • Manage automation performance, including maintenance and issue resolution
  • Lead and develop a high-performing team fostering safety, excellence, and innovation

Qualifications:

  • Management experience in e-commerce or automation
  • Knowledge of warehouse control systems and automated distribution
  • Strong communication, analytical skills, and ability to lead under pressure
  • Passion for process improvement and operational excellence
